Spice up your office space with a new ceiling treatment. Most ceilings are painted flat white and that’s that. But your ceiling can be beautiful and add to the overall ambiance of your office space. Here are a few tips on how to make your ceiling something special.

  • Add color. If your walls are white, add a subtle touch of color to your ceiling. Or add two or three parts of white paint to your wall paint for a smooth, coordinated effect. You can also use a contrasting color for dramatic effect, but don’t overwhelm the room with the ceiling color. Try out a test patch first.
  • Add interest. Use your ceiling to create impact by covering it or adding embellishments. For example, tin ceilings hide flaws and come in a variety of colors and finishes. You can get the look of tin at a lower price with recycled paper that’s pressed to look like tin. Or use embossed wallpaper on your ceiling to add some old-fashioned charm. Crown mouldings and light fixture medallions also add interest, and can be stained or painted for the desired effect.
  • Control the sense of height. If you have a room with a ceiling lower than eight feet, you can give it a sense of spaciousness by painting the ceiling a shade or two lighter than the walls. Use satin-finish paint with a little lustre in small or dark rooms to reflect available light. A room with a high ceiling will look cozier if you paint the ceiling a shade or two darker than the walls.
